Evaluate the Scuff
Identify the Type of Scuff: Determine whether the scuff is surface-level or deeper. Surface-level scuffs are easier to remove, while much deeper marks might need more effort.Tidy the Area: Use a microfiber fabric and warm water to wipe down the scuffed location. This removes any dirt or particles that might disrupt the cleansing procedure.
Moderate Cleaning Methods
Dish Soap and Water: Mix a percentage of mild meal soap with warm water. Dip a soft-bristled brush into the solution and gently scrub the scuffed area. Wash with a clean, moist fabric and dry completely.Sodium Bicarbonate Paste: Create a paste by blending sodium bicarbonate and water. Use the paste to the scuff and let it sit for a few minutes. Carefully scrub with a soft-bristled brush and wipe clean with a moist fabric. Dry the location thoroughly.
Moderate Cleaning Methods
Tooth paste: Apply a percentage of non-gel tooth paste to the scuff. Utilize a soft cloth to rub the tooth paste in a circular movement. Wipe away the tooth paste with a moist fabric and dry the location.White Vinegar: Dampen a fabric with white vinegar and gently rub the scuffed location. Rinse with water and dry thoroughly.
Advanced Cleaning Methods
Mineral Spirits: If the scuff is persistent, use a percentage of mineral spirits to a fabric. Carefully rub the scuff, being careful not to use excessive pressure. Clean the location with a tidy, wet fabric and dry completely.Steel Wool: For much deeper scuffs, utilize 0000-grade steel wool. Gently rub the scuff in a circular movement. Be cautious to avoid scratching the surface. Clean the area clean with a moist fabric and dry thoroughly.Preventing Future Scuffs
Preventing scuffs on composite doors is simply as crucial as removing them. Here are some tips to keep your door looking its best:
Regular Cleaning: Clean your composite door frequently with a moderate soap and water solution to get rid of dirt and gunk.Use Door Mats: Place door mats at the entry points to decrease the amount of dirt and debris that can be tracked onto the door.Prevent Harsh Chemicals: Use only moderate cleaner to avoid damaging the door's finish.Protective Coatings: Consider using a protective coating to the door to enhance its resistance to scuffs and marks.Frequently asked questions
